![]() The Curio machiné is limited tó an 8.5 inch by 12 inch cutting surface. For example, yóu could print ánd cut, ór print and émboss, or even usé two different coIored pens. The cutting width of the Cameo is 12 inches, and it can cut up to 10 feet long without a mat. This is gréat if you aré making large bannérs or home décor. This is hándy if you aré traveling with thé machine and wónt have access tó a computer. Most differences are with the capabilities and cutting width. However, the Curió can use materiaIs as much ás 5mm thick and cut materials such as foam and leather, which will require a deep cut blade. With some éxperimentation, however, you couId try embossing ón softthink metals. The Curio is designed to have more variety when it comes to capabilities, like embossing and etching, but the Cameo with its 12-inch cutting width is best for cutting materials.
